Job Vacancy: Social & Inclusion Rugby League Officer

February 18, 2025

Wakefield Trinity Community Foundation are looking for a Social and Inclusion Rugby League Officer to join our Rugby League department.

The Social and Inclusion Rugby League Officer will report directly to the Community Rugby League Manager and will have an active involvement in our Social and Inclusion Provision, delivering a number of high-quality sessions each day, at delivery sites across the Wakefield District and surrounding areas. The successful candidate will work closely with the Head of Foundation and Community Rugby League Manager to make sure all aspects of delivery are run to the highest of standards.
